Output dfb29cd5c9647882421e88d81bab672c7d31e63eb3ddfa13f01d34028a8880f2:1

value
18743292
script pubkey
OP_0 OP_PUSHBYTES_32 f2b9e808c5ea7fbdf0f46c02e1907954564f8a16c4edb5fb987468969447667a
address
bc1q72u7szx9aflmmu85dspwryre23tylzskcnkmt7ucw35fd9z8veaqlu5dfg
transaction
dfb29cd5c9647882421e88d81bab672c7d31e63eb3ddfa13f01d34028a8880f2
confirmations
172723
spent
true